Rolex Parts List and Technical Information Is Now Online
Hi Everyone,
I just wanted to let you know that I am in the process of putting together the ultimate vintage Rolex reference source in one place. I am slowly digitizing all my Rolex parts lists and technical information that I have. Some of this stuff is available online already, but it is scattered all over. It is my hope that this information helps collectors and watchmakers alike. If you have anything in particular that you need that is not up yet please let me know and I will try to put it next in the queue. I hope this information serves you all well. Here is the link to the page: https://ashtontracy.ca/rolex-references-2/ Navigate the different calibers via the submenu. Ashton |
